Mailerlite Automation Guide: A Simple Approach

Mailerlite delivers a powerful suite of automation features, and getting started doesn't demand to be challenging. Let’s walk you through a initial step-by-step method to build your first automatic email chain. First, navigate to your Mailerlite account. Then, locate the "Automation" part - it’s usually located in the left-hand navigation. Click the "Create Automation" option; you'll be shown with various initiators, like a new subscriber, a purchase, or a specific date. Select the stimulus that best matches your goals. Next, add steps to your automation – these could be sending emails, adding tags, or updating subscriber details. Finally, check your system carefully and then launch it! Experimenting with multiple triggers and actions is key to understanding Mailerlite’s automation potential.
